Yesil Global Enerji A.S. (PWRU)
Yesil Global Enerji A.S. is a Turkish energy company that builds and operates landfill gas-to-energy and biogas-to-energy facilities, converting methane and other biogas captured from municipal waste into grid-stable electricity. Founded in 2007, the company has become one of Turkey’s largest waste-to-energy operators, with six landfill gas facilities across the country, including the Avcikoru plant, the largest waste-to-energy production facility in the country by generation. The company sells electricity to Turkey’s national grid and industrial customers, and in recent years has begun exploring expansion into North American natural gas production and geothermal projects, positioning itself as a broader renewable and alternative-energy play beyond its waste-to-energy core.
The energy sector in Turkey has grown more complex and competitive since the country’s electricity market was liberalized in the 2000s. Waste-to-energy facilities occupy a distinctive position: they convert a waste-disposal problem—the methane and other gases emitted from landfills that contribute to climate change—into a tangible energy product sold to a captive buyer (the grid operator). This gives waste-to-energy projects long-lived, relatively predictable cash flows, since they rest on two inelastic foundations: waste must go somewhere, and grids need power. Yesil Global Enerji’s position in this niche has made it a recurring revenue generator as Turkish waste volumes have grown and the government has encouraged renewable-energy capacity.
The company’s operational footprint covers six landfill sites across Turkey, with the Avcikoru facility in the Marmara region serving as the flagship asset. These facilities use proven technology: gas collection pipes in the landfill body capture methane-rich biogas, which is then piped to combustion engines that drive generators, converting the gas into electricity. The Avcikoru plant alone has installed capacity of roughly 20 megawatts, meaning it can generate significant power during peak collection periods. Revenue comes from feed-in tariff contracts—guaranteed prices per kilowatt-hour of electricity sold to the grid—and from industrial customers who purchase power directly.
Turkey’s renewable-energy landscape has been shaped by policy incentives and regulatory frameworks. The government has supported renewable and waste-to-energy projects through tariff guarantees, favorable tax treatment, and renewable-portfolio standards that require utilities to source a minimum percentage of power from clean sources. These policies create a stable backdrop for companies like Yesil Global Enerji, though they can also shift with political priorities and fiscal pressures. Feed-in tariffs in Turkey have been generous relative to some European countries, but they are subject to renegotiation and budget constraints.
Waste-to-energy is a capital-intensive business. Building a landfill gas capture system, installing gas engines, and connecting to the grid requires upfront investment of millions of euros per facility. The payback period is typically ten to fifteen years, meaning the company must manage the long-term reliability of its assets and maintain stable revenue streams. Yesil Global Enerji has demonstrated the ability to identify and develop these projects, secure long-term power-purchase agreements, and sustain operations across multiple sites.
Beyond Turkey, the company has recognized the North American market as a significant growth opportunity. It established a subsidiary, Power Upp USA, to pursue opportunities in natural gas production and geothermal energy in the United States. This expansion reflects both a desire to diversify geographically and a bet that natural gas and geothermal projects, especially integrated with data-center power needs, represent the next growth vector. Data centers consume enormous amounts of electricity, and operators increasingly seek reliable, on-site or nearby generation capacity. Yesil Global Enerji’s thesis appears to be that its operational expertise in converting methane and managing power generation can be deployed into higher-margin U.S. markets.
The company filed to raise approximately $86 million through an initial public offering of American Depositary Shares on the NASDAQ Capital Market under the symbol PWRU. The offering represents a strategic milestone: access to public capital in the United States, where the company intends to fund expansion of its North American operations, continue research and development into geothermal and advanced technologies, and strengthen its balance sheet. The proceeds would support the transition from a pure-play Turkish waste-to-energy operator to a geographically diversified, multi-technology renewable-energy producer.

The company’s financial profile reflects the waste-to-energy business model. Revenues come primarily from electricity sales at tariffed rates, which are relatively stable and predictable. Operating costs include gas collection and processing, equipment maintenance, and grid connection fees—all largely variable or contracted in advance, giving the business good visibility. The largest variable is the volume of waste landfilled, which fluctuates with regional economic activity and waste-management policies. Capital expenditure is front-loaded (when building new facilities) but drops sharply once facilities are operational, creating opportunities for cash generation from mature assets.
The company booked approximately $53 million in revenue for the twelve-month period ended June 30, 2025, reflecting the scale and maturity of its Turkish portfolio. This revenue base is substantial for a regional Turkish operator but modest in the context of global renewable-energy companies. The profitability and cash-flow characteristics depend on the tariff rates locked into long-term contracts, the operational efficiency of each facility, and the company’s ability to manage capital intensity as it expands.
